The Flying Classroom

January 16, 2003 1h 50m 6.0/10 (40 votes)

Originally released in 2003. The Flying Classroom is a comedy/drama film. directed by Tomy Wigand.

Starring Ulrich Noethen, Sebastian Koch, and Piet Klocke

Synopsis

A boy who was once a perpetual outcast finds friends in a new boarding school. United with his new peers, he gets involved in a heated rivalry with a group of students from a neighboring school.
